WebKey Steps in Solving Exponential Equations without Logarithms. Make the base on both sides of the equation the SAME. so that if \large {b^ {\color {blue}M}} = {b^ {\color {red}N}} bM = bN. then {\color {blue}M} = {\color {red}N} M = N. In other words, if you can express the exponential equations to have the same base on both sides, then it is ...

WebExample. Solve 5x+2 =4x 5 x + 2 = 4 x. In general we can solve exponential equations whose terms do not have like bases in the following way: Apply the logarithm to both sides of the equation. If one of the terms in the equation has base 10 10, use the common logarithm.
